MAKKAH — Kidana Development Company, the executive arm of the Royal Commission for Makkah City and Holy Sites, has completed phase two of the shading and cooling project surrounding Mount Arafat for the 2026 Hajj season. The project increases the utilization of shaded and cooled areas for pilgrims fivefold compared to last year. The project, across its first and second phases, covers a total area exceeding 272,000 square meters. Synergy Research Group recently unveiled their findings about global cloud infrastructure spending by enterprises. The group determined that the spending had surpassed an annualised run rate of half-a-trillion dollars for the first time, driven largely by accelerating generative AI (GenAI) demand. Quarterly revenue of $128.6 billion in Q1 2026 represents a 35% year-on-year jump. The Federal Communications Commission (FCC) recently approved new rules designed to unlock a seven-fold capacity boost for satellite broadband services. This move would in turn benefit SpaceX’s Starlink service. A unanimous vote by the FCC’s three commissioners ends a regulatory framework dating back to the late 1990s which limited the amount of energy satellite systems could transmit to and from ground equipment. JEDDAH — Saudi Minister of Foreign Affairs Prince Faisal bin Farhan met with Minister of Foreign Affairs of Singapore Dr. Vivian Balakrishnan in Jeddah on Monday. During the meeting, the ministers reviewed bilateral relations between the two countries. They discussed ways to further enhance bilateral cooperation between the two countries in various fields. The latest developments in the region also figured highly in their meeting. The ministers emphasized the need to support efforts aimed at protecting and ensuring the stability of waterways, thereby strengthening regional and international peace and security.
